Dick Van Dyke - 96

Dick Van Dyle is 96 and he has no plans for retirement. With a 7-decade-long career, he is still working and recently reprised his role as Mr. Dawes Jr. on Mary Poppins Returns, in 2018. He gained peak levels of fame with his Dick Van Dyke Show from the ‘60s, but also starred in musicals like Bye Bye BirdieMary Poppins, and Chitty Chitty Bang Bang. Van Dyke has five Primetime Emmys, one Tony, and one Grammy award, and has a star on the Hollywood Walk of Fame.
